Understanding Commitment Fees in Financial Markets

Commitment fees are a common feature in financial markets, representing a payment made by a borrower to a lender in exchange for the lender's guarantee to provide a specific amount of funding within a pre-agreed timeframe. Essentially, it's a fee for the promise of money, not the money itself. This assurance is valuable to the borrower, offering certainty and reducing risk in their financial planning. However, the borrower pays a price for this convenience.

How Commitment Fees Work:

A commitment fee is usually structured as a percentage of the total committed amount and is typically paid periodically, often monthly or quarterly, throughout the commitment period. This period represents the time frame during which the lender is obligated to provide the funds. The fee is charged irrespective of whether the borrower ultimately draws down the full committed amount or any portion of it. This is a key difference compared to interest, which is only charged on the amount of funds actually borrowed.

Example:

Imagine a company secures a $10 million credit facility with a 0.5% annual commitment fee and a 4% annual interest rate. If the commitment period is one year, the company will pay a commitment fee of $50,000 (0.5% of $10 million) regardless of whether they borrow any money. If they borrow the full $10 million for the entire year, they will also pay $400,000 in interest. If they only borrow $5 million for six months, they still pay the full $50,000 commitment fee, plus interest on the $5 million for six months.

Why are Commitment Fees Charged?

Lenders charge commitment fees to compensate them for the opportunity cost of tying up their capital and for the administrative work involved in setting up and maintaining the credit facility. By committing funds, the lender foregoes the opportunity to invest that capital elsewhere or to lend it to another borrower. Furthermore, there are costs associated with due diligence, legal documentation, and ongoing monitoring of the borrower. The fee is meant to cover these costs and provide a return for the lender's commitment.

Who Uses Commitment Fees?

Commitment fees are prevalent in various financial instruments, including:

  • Term Loans: Often used by businesses for specific projects or acquisitions.
  • Credit Lines: Provide businesses with access to funds as needed, up to a pre-approved limit.
  • Project Finance: Used for large-scale infrastructure projects.
  • Syndicated Loans: Involve multiple lenders, each contributing a portion of the committed amount.

Factors Affecting Commitment Fees:

Several factors influence the size of the commitment fee, including:

  • Creditworthiness of the borrower: Higher-risk borrowers typically pay higher commitment fees.
  • Size of the commitment: Larger commitments may attract lower fees due to economies of scale.
  • Length of the commitment period: Longer periods usually result in higher fees.
  • Market conditions: Prevailing interest rates and overall market sentiment can impact commitment fees.

Exercise: Calculating Commitment Fees and Interest

Scenario:

Your company, "InnovateTech," needs a $20 million credit facility for a new product launch. You've secured a 1-year term with a lender offering the following terms:

  • Commitment Fee: 0.6% annually
  • Interest Rate: 4.5% annually
  • Drawdown: You plan to draw down $15 million immediately and the remaining $5 million in 6 months.

Task 1: Calculate the total commitment fee InnovateTech will pay over the year.

Task 2: Calculate the total interest InnovateTech will pay over the year. Assume simple interest for this calculation.

Task 3: What is the total cost (commitment fee + interest) of this financing?

Exercice CorrectionTask 1: Total Commitment Fee

The commitment fee is 0.6% of $20 million per year, regardless of drawdown.

Commitment Fee = 0.006 * $20,000,000 = $120,000

Task 2: Total Interest

  • First $15 million: Interest for a full year: 0.045 * $15,000,000 = $675,000
  • Second $5 million: Interest for 6 months (0.5 years): 0.045 * $5,000,000 * 0.5 = $112,500

Total Interest = $675,000 + $112,500 = $787,500

Task 3: Total Cost

Total Cost = Commitment Fee + Total Interest = $120,000 + $787,500 = $907,500

Therefore, the total cost of the financing for InnovateTech will be $907,500.

Chapter 1: Techniques for Calculating and Structuring Commitment Fees

Commitment fees are calculated as a percentage of the total committed amount, usually paid periodically (monthly or quarterly) throughout the commitment period. The calculation is straightforward:

Commitment Fee = Committed Amount × Commitment Fee Rate × Time Fraction

Where:

  • Committed Amount: The total amount of funds the lender has committed to provide.
  • Commitment Fee Rate: The annual percentage rate charged as a commitment fee.
  • Time Fraction: The portion of the year for which the fee is being calculated (e.g., 1/12 for a monthly payment, 1/4 for a quarterly payment).

Structuring Commitment Fees: Negotiation plays a significant role. Borrowers can explore various structures to potentially reduce their overall cost:

  • Tiered Fees: The commitment fee rate might decrease as the committed amount increases, reflecting economies of scale for the lender.
  • Step-Down Fees: The fee rate could decrease over time, reflecting reduced risk as the commitment period progresses.
  • Fee waivers: Partial or full waivers might be negotiated under certain conditions, such as achieving specific performance milestones.
  • Relationship pricing: Established borrowers with a strong history with the lender might negotiate lower rates.

Sophisticated structuring techniques require careful analysis of the borrower’s cash flow projections and risk tolerance.

Chapter 2: Models for Predicting and Forecasting Commitment Fees

Predicting commitment fees requires understanding the various factors influencing them. Several models can be used:

  • Regression Models: Statistical models can be built to relate commitment fees to factors like credit rating, loan size, commitment period, and market conditions. Data from past transactions can be used to estimate the coefficients of the model. However, the accuracy depends on data availability and the stability of the relationships over time.
  • Benchmarking: Comparing fees charged on similar transactions in the market provides a reasonable estimate. This requires accessing industry databases or engaging financial advisors with market expertise.
  • Financial Models: Sophisticated financial models used by lenders incorporate various risk metrics and market expectations to determine an appropriate commitment fee. These are often proprietary and not publicly available.

Accurate forecasting is crucial for both borrowers and lenders. Borrowers can use these models to anticipate costs and plan their financing strategies, while lenders can optimize their pricing strategy and manage their risk exposure.

Chapter 5: Case Studies Illustrating Commitment Fee Applications

Case Study 1: A Small Business Securing a Line of Credit: A small business owner, needing a flexible line of credit for working capital, secured a $250,000 facility with a 0.75% annual commitment fee and a 6% interest rate. Due to slow sales, they only drew down $100,000 over the year, still incurring the full commitment fee, highlighting the importance of accurate cash flow forecasting.

Case Study 2: A Large Corporation Financing a Major Acquisition: A large corporation needed a substantial syndicated loan to acquire a competitor. They secured a $500 million loan with a tiered commitment fee structure, reducing the rate as the total commitment approached the full amount, reflecting economies of scale for the lending syndicate. Successful negotiation of a tiered structure resulted in significant cost savings.

Case Study 3: A Project Finance Deal for a Renewable Energy Project: A developer financing a large-scale wind farm negotiated a step-down commitment fee structure, with the rate decreasing after certain milestones (like obtaining permits and completing initial construction) were achieved, reflecting the decreasing risk to the lenders as the project progressed.

These case studies illustrate the diversity of commitment fee applications and the importance of understanding the specific circumstances of each transaction. They highlight the benefits and drawbacks of different fee structures and the role of effective negotiation in managing costs.
